加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.577idc.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 站长学院 > MsSql教程 > 正文

精通SQL Server存储管理与触发器应用

发布时间:2026-05-15 08:41:21 所属栏目:MsSql教程 来源:DaWei
导读:  SQL Server的存储管理是数据库性能优化的核心环节。合理规划数据文件与日志文件的布局,能显著提升系统响应速度。建议将数据文件(.mdf)和事务日志文件(.ldf)放置在不同物理磁盘上,以减少I/O争用。同时,定期

  SQL Server的存储管理是数据库性能优化的核心环节。合理规划数据文件与日志文件的布局,能显著提升系统响应速度。建议将数据文件(.mdf)和事务日志文件(.ldf)放置在不同物理磁盘上,以减少I/O争用。同时,定期监控文件增长情况,避免自动增长频繁触发导致的性能波动。通过设置合理的初始大小与最大值,可有效控制存储资源的使用效率。


  在存储结构设计中,文件组的使用能够增强数据组织的灵活性。用户可根据业务需求创建多个文件组,将高频访问的表或索引分配至特定文件组,实现更精细的存储管理。例如,将历史数据归入只读文件组,既便于维护,又能减少写操作对主数据区的影响。


  触发器作为数据库的自动化工具,在保障数据完整性方面发挥着重要作用。当某张表发生插入、更新或删除操作时,触发器可以自动执行预定义逻辑。例如,记录操作日志、验证数据合法性或同步关联表数据。通过在关键业务表上部署触发器,可有效防止非法操作带来的数据异常。


2026AI模拟图,仅供参考

  然而,触发器的使用需谨慎。过多或复杂的触发器会增加数据库负担,影响DML操作的执行效率。建议仅在必要场景启用触发器,并确保其逻辑简洁高效。同时,应配合文档说明触发器的功能与触发条件,便于后期维护与排查问题。


  结合存储管理与触发器应用,不仅能提升数据库的稳定性和安全性,还能为业务系统的持续运行提供有力支撑。掌握这两项技术的关键在于理解实际需求,平衡性能与维护成本,从而构建高效可靠的数据库环境。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章